Job Profile for Welder / Fabricator 46203
Location: Alness, Scottish Highlands
Salary: Up to £18.50 per hour
Hours: Monday to Friday, 07:30 – 17:00 (45 hours per week)
Overview
We are currently recruiting for an experienced Fabricator / Welder on behalf of a well-established engineering and manufacturing business.
This is an excellent opportunity to join a busy and growing workshop environment, working on a variety of fabrication projects and producing high-quality components.
Key Responsibilities
Fabrication of metal components from engineering drawings
MIG and/or TIG welding to a high standard
Cutting, bending, and assembling materials
Working with a range of materials including mild steel, stainless steel, and aluminium
Ensuring all work meets required quality standards
Carrying out basic inspections of completed work
Maintaining a safe and organised working environment
Working independently and as part of a team to meet production deadlines
Requirements
Proven experience as a Fabricator / Welder
Ability to read and interpret engineering drawings
Experience with MIG and/or TIG welding
Strong attention to detail and quality
Good understanding of health & safety within a workshop environment
Reliable and able to meet deadlines
Desirable
Relevant welding or fabrication qualifications
Experience using workshop machinery (press brake, guillotine, etc.)
Previous experience in a manufacturing or engineering environment
Benefits
Competitive hourly rate up to £18.50
Overtime opportunities available
Full-time, stable position
Opportunity to work with an established and supportive team
